Wiltsey, Clerk CITY OF SHOREWOOD • �I 0 0 R n August 17, 1973 MEMORANDUM • Re: Village of Shorewood - Proposed Schwanke Subdivision Attached hereto is a proposed plan and division of the Schwanke property located on Edgewood Road. This proposed division leaves a 32 acre parcel of property which has no frontage on a public road other than a 55 foot permanent easement. Ordinance No. 11, Subdivision 4, pro- vides that every parcel of land shall have a frontage on a public road of not less than 100 feet. The ordinance also provides that 100 feet may be decreased by unanimous vote of the village council. It is the interpretation of our office that although the village council may reduce the number of feet necessary on a public road, it cannot eliminate it entirely and that there must be some reason- able amount of frontage on a public road, i.e. 25 to 30 feet. Wiltsey Clerk- Trews. , .. - , - - . , i ;. ' '„'rv,,. •. -. V i November 21 1973 STATE OF MINNESOTA DEPARTMENT OF HIGHWAYS CIST R iC 7 NCB 5 2055 NO. LILAC DRIVE MINNEAPOLIS, MINN. NW- John A. Lev0riug 25170 Yellowstone Trail Excelsior, Ntm osota 55331 Dear Mr. Levsriegs A copy of your letter, dated Oesober 23, 1973, was recently forwarded to the MIMMsota Righway Department by the Village of Shorewood. A review Of the iutersoction of T*R* 7 and Pleasant Avenue was made by the District "KIAtosuae Eugiueor, Mlaintenamm Superintendent and mmyself. It was our conMnsus that the roadway surface Of Pleasant Avenue was increased in width during utility soustruction in the area. Unfortunately, the roadway shoulder,, slopes and drainage structures were not also modified. Because of the lack of shoulders on Pleasant Avenge, it is undesirable to • place a trrlffic barrier as you suggest. Heather perditting this fall, or for Cartel* Sena sprig, we will modify the drainage structures, install shoulders and lesson the slopes on that portion of Pleasant Avenue, which lies within State right of way. However. a portion of the problem along Pleasant Avenue falls outside of State right of way and will have to be taken oars of by the Village of Shorewood. With the addition of shoulders and slope modification, the hazard along Pleasant Avenue adjacent to T.B. 7 will be eliminated without the need of a traffic barrier. Year keen observations and interest in the potential hazard along Pleasant Avenue is most appreciated. Sincerely, R. L. Hoppenrath Naintenang* Operations Engivaer RLHfja ccr Village of Shorewood, P.
